Overview
A key lesson of the COVID pandemic is that future preparedness critically depends on strengthening public sector capacity and budgets. International financial institutions and national ministries of health must thus recognize the harm done by austerity, as implemented across many countries and levels of government – making the crisis much worse than it had to be: estimated deaths are 2.5 to 3.4 times greater than official reporting by countries.
